Chauna is a Rural village located in Ganai-gangoli, Pithoragarh, Uttarakhand.
The total population of Chauna is 302.
Chauna village comprises 66 households.
The literacy rate in Chauna is 70.4%. Among the literate population of 178, there are 87 literate males and 91 literate females.
In Chauna, there are 137 males and 165 females, with a sex ratio of 1204 females per 1000 males.
There are 49 children (16.2% of population), comprising 32 boys and 17 girls.
The total number of workers in Chauna is 109, with 107 main workers and 2 marginal workers.

Chauna is located in Uttarakhand state, Pithoragarh district, and falls under Ganai-gangoli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 49976 and LGD code is 49976.
